&lt;div class="wikidoc"&gt;
&lt;h1&gt;Overview:&lt;/h1&gt;
I am happy to release the first version of the Metro Weather WebPart. This WebPart was created due to the lack of (in my opinion) good looking weather WebParts available. The WebPart has multiple modes, built in caching, XSLT rendering and a great look. See
 below for the release and its features.&lt;br&gt;
Features:&lt;br&gt;
&lt;ul&gt;
&lt;li&gt;7 different Colours - Red, Yellow, Blue, Light Blue, Purple, Green, Light Green
&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;4 different layouts - Horizontal, Vertical, Horizontal Summary, Vertical Summary
&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;XSLT Rendering - Change how you want the weather to render &l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;Free Online API - http://www.worldweatheronline.com/. Allows 500 API Calls an hour. (Please ensure if using a free API key that you keep the &amp;quot;Credit to World Weather Online intact&amp;quot;)
&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;Caching - WebPart caches data every minute to ensure api limit is not reached.
&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;CSS - Styled via css stored in Style library to ensure you are able to customise layout easier.
&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;Multiple measures - Display speeds in mph, or km/h and temperature in Celsius or Fahrenheit&lt;/li&gt;&lt;/ul&gt;
&lt;h1&gt;How to use:&lt;/h1&gt;
To use the new Metro Weather WebPart first download and upload the solution to your site collection. After you have activated the feature you are then able to add the WebPart onto the Page and configure the webpart to display the weather information of your
 choice.&lt;br&gt;
&lt;br&gt;
The WebPart has the following properties that can be configured at set:&lt;br&gt;
&lt;ul&gt;
&lt;li&gt;Weather Location - This is the most complex property to complete. This is a comma and semi-colon delimited string which will configure the location that will be displayed, its colour and if required a different display name.
&lt;ul&gt;
&lt;li&gt;The string should be in the following format: Location{Display Name},Colour;Location{Display Name},Colour
&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;Examples from the screenshot above would be: London,red;Las Vegas{Sin City},blue;New York,green;
&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;If you emit the {Display Name} then the city name from the xml results will be displayed instead.
&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;The avaliable colours are shown in the features above.&lt;/li&gt;&lt;/ul&gt;
&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;Number of Days forecast (Max 5) - This sets the number of days forecast that can be displayed. (The Free API enabled a max of 5)
&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;API Key - Before you are able to use the webpart you will need to sign up for an API key at http://www.worldweatheronline.com/register.aspx
&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;XSLT Path - This is the XSLT path for the WebPart. The default setting should be: http://servername/Style Library/LifeInSharePoint.Weather/xslt/Weather.xslt
&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;Display Type - Sets the display type of the WebPart. Horizontal, Vertical, SummaryHorizontal, SummaryVertical.
&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;Temperature Display - Sets the temperature setting to either centigrade, or fahrenheit.
&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;Speed Display - Sets the wind speed to be displayed in either Mph, or Kph.&lt;/li&gt;&lt;/ul&gt;
